CodeTwo Email Signatures
enterpriseOffers rule-based email signature management for on-premises Exchange, Office 365, and Gmail with advanced customization and automation.
Server-side signature injection that dynamically modifies emails in transit, working seamlessly across Outlook, webmail, and mobile clients without end-user setup.
CodeTwo Email Signatures is a server-side email signature management solution designed for Microsoft Exchange, Office 365, and Outlook environments. It enables centralized control over signatures, disclaimers, and footers across all users and devices without requiring client-side installations. Administrators can create dynamic, HTML-based signatures that pull data from Active Directory, such as photos, titles, and contact details, with rule-based logic for customization and approvals.
Pros
- Server-side deployment eliminates client installations and ensures consistency across all email clients and devices
- Advanced dynamic signatures with AD integration, user photos, and conditional rules
- Robust compliance features including approvals, versioning, and multi-tenant support
Cons
- Primarily optimized for Microsoft ecosystems, with limited native support for non-Microsoft platforms
- Initial server setup and configuration can require IT expertise
- Pricing scales with mailbox count, which may be costly for very large enterprises without discounts
Best For
Medium to large organizations using Microsoft Exchange or Office 365 that need enterprise-grade, centralized signature management for branding and compliance.
Pricing
Starts at $1.20 per mailbox/month (annual billing) with tiered plans and volume discounts; free trial available.

Crossware
enterpriseManages email signatures and disclaimers across multiple email servers including Exchange and SMTP with policy controls.
Server-side dynamic signature rendering from Active Directory without client-side code
Crossware Mail Signature Management is a centralized platform designed for organizations to create, deploy, and manage email signatures across Microsoft Exchange, Office 365, and Google Workspace environments. It enables dynamic signatures that pull data from Active Directory or LDAP, supporting features like HTML design, disclaimers, and multi-language content. The solution emphasizes compliance with GDPR, HIPAA, and other regulations through secure banner management and audit trails.
Pros
- Seamless integration with Microsoft Exchange and Office 365
- Dynamic signatures based on Active Directory attributes
- Strong compliance tools including GDPR and disclaimers
Cons
- Setup requires IT expertise and server-side installation
- Pricing is quote-based and can be higher for smaller teams
- Limited native support for non-Microsoft platforms without add-ons
Best For
Mid-sized to large enterprises in Microsoft-heavy environments needing compliant, dynamic email signatures.
Pricing
Custom quote-based pricing, typically $1.50-$3 per user per month depending on volume and features.
